To make an HTTP request in JavaScript, you can use the XMLHttpRequest object or the newer fetch API. Here's an example of using both methods:


Using XMLHttpRequest:

var xhr = new XMLHttpRequest();

xhr.open('GET', 'https://api.example.com/data', true);


xhr.onreadystatechange = function() {

  if (xhr.readyState === 4 && xhr.status === 200) {

    var response = JSON.parse(xhr.responseText);

    // Process the response here

    console.log(response);

  }

};


xhr.send();

Using fetch:

fetch('https://api.example.com/data')

  .then(function(response) {

    if (response.ok) {

      return response.json();

    } else {

      throw new Error('Error: ' + response.status);

    }

  })

  .then(function(data) {

    // Process the data here

    console.log(data);

  })

  .catch(function(error) {

    // Handle any errors here

    console.error(error);

  });

In both cases, you specify the URL you want to send the request to. You can use different HTTP methods (e.g., GET, POST, PUT, DELETE) by adjusting the open() method or by passing additional options to the fetch() function.


Note: The fetch API is more modern and provides a simpler and more powerful interface for making HTTP requests. However, the XMLHttpRequest object is still widely supported in older browsers.
